Hand-thrown in Vancouver, this elegant stoneware vase embodies the quiet balance between form, colour, and the unpredictability of the kiln. Its softly rounded silhouette tapers into a delicate neck, creating a timeless profile that feels equally at home displaying freshly gathered blooms or standing alone as a sculptural object.
Finished in a luminous Floating Blue glaze, the surface shifts between misty blues and soft seafoam greens, revealing subtle speckles and flowing variations unique to the firing process. Fine throwing lines remain visible beneath the glaze, preserving the rhythm of the maker's hand and celebrating the vessel's handmade origins.
Inspired by the changing tones of the West Coast landscape—where sky, water, and earth meet—this vase invites a sense of calm and contemplation into the home. Whether styled with seasonal branches, a simple arrangement of garden flowers, or appreciated as an object in its own right, it offers beauty through both utility and presence.
Each vase is individually wheel-thrown and glazed by hand, ensuring that no two are exactly alike.
